Chipley is about an hour north of Panama City. It's been many years since we've driven through there. We used to drive the back road down from Alabama to Panama City and go through Chipley. Back then, it was a country kind of road. Chipley had a few lovely little historic looking homes, a thrift shop & used furniture stores that we would stop in and browse. Of course, so much has changed in our region over the past 10 years that we really don't know what's going on over in Chipley any more. With a new international airport being built in the West Bay of Panama City Beach, we are certain there have been some development changes and additions. Panama City would be the nearest city or if you wanted to go more north, it would be Dothan, Alabama or even further north -- Montgomery.
